Carlos´s Salvadoran Fish Ceviche Recipe –

Ingredients:

  • 2 Lbs Talapia
  • 1 Red Bell Pepper
  • 1 Orange Bell Pepper
  • 1 Yellow Bell Pepper
  • ½ Red Onion
  • â…“ White Onion
  • Many Limes
  • Dried Oregano
  • Salt

Directions:

  • Juice enough limes to cover the fish
  • Cut the fish in ½ inch by ½ inch cubes
  • Toss the fish in Salt and let sit for 15 minutes
  • Chop the Bell Peppers and Onions
  • Rinse the Salt off of the Fish with water and Drain
  • Cover the Fish in Lime Juice
  • Pour the Vegetables over the Fish and Lime Juice
  • Sprinkle with Oregano to taste
  • Cover and refrigerate around 30 minutes (until the fish is white)
  • Toss the Salvadoran Fish Ceviche and enjoy with Crackers and a Cold Beer
